What Are Computer Shortcut Keys?
Computer shortcut key – Keyboard key combination that executes certain operations extremely fast.
For example:
- Ctrl + C → Copy
- Ctrl + V → Paste
- Ctrl + S → Save
- Ctrl + Z → Undo
These commands reduce mouse usage and help users’ complete tasks efficiently.

Essential Computer Shortcut Keys List

Basic Keyboard Shortcuts
| Shortcut Key | Function |
| Ctrl + C | Copy |
| Ctrl + V | Paste |
| Ctrl + X | Cut |
| Ctrl + Z | Undo |
| Ctrl + Y | Redo |
| Ctrl + A | Select All |
| Ctrl + S | Save |

Windows Shortcut Keys Chart
| Shortcut | Action |
| Windows + D | Show Desktop |
| Windows + E | Open File Explorer |
| Windows + L | Lock Computer |
| Alt + Tab | Switch Apps |
| Windows + I | Settings |
| Windows + Shift + S | Screenshot |
| Ctrl + Shift + Esc | Task Manager |
| Windows + V | Clipboard History |
Windows shortcuts are especially useful for students managing assignments and online classes.
Browser Shortcut Keys
Modern learning depends heavily on browsers.
| Shortcut | Purpose |
| Ctrl + T | Open New Tab |
| Ctrl + W | Close Tab |
| Ctrl + Shift + T | Restore Closed Tab |
| Ctrl + L | Address Bar |
| Ctrl + R | Refresh |
| Ctrl + D | Bookmark |
| Ctrl + H | History |
These shortcuts help students research faster.
Microsoft Word Shortcut Keys
For writing assignments and reports:
| Shortcut | Function |
| Ctrl + B | Bold |
| Ctrl + I | Italic |
| Ctrl + U | Underline |
| Ctrl + K | Insert Link |
| Ctrl + Enter | Page Break |
| F7 | Spell Check |
These shortcuts save time while preparing documents.

Troubleshooting Keyboard Shortcut Problems
Shortcut Keys Not Working?
Try these solutions:
Restart the Application
Some programs temporarily stop recognizing shortcuts.
Check Keyboard Settings
Make sure keys are working correctly.
Disable Conflicting Software
Gaming keyboards and customization tools may block shortcuts.
Update Drivers
Outdated keyboard drivers can cause problems.
